背景情况:

  • 物联网 (IoT) 生态系统正在快速扩展,增加对网络威胁的易感性.
  • 物联网设备的漏洞使它们成为恶意行为者的首要目标,构成重大安全风险.
  • 现有的独立威胁检测系统不足以保护复杂的物联网环境.

研究的目的:

  • 为增强物联网安全引入创新的基于Swarm的在线机器学习 (SIML) 方法.
  • 开发一个分布式和端到端的安全解决方案,以应对物联网环境中新出现的恶意软件威胁.
  • 为了减少物联网设备被利用进行网络攻击的风险.

主要方法:

  • 拟议的Swarm-based Inline Machine Learning (SIML) 方法利用了协调的群体数据处理.
  • 梯度增强树算法在SIML框架内用于威胁检测.
  • 使用UNSW-NB15,BoT-Iot和Edge-IIoTset数据集进行了严格的测试.

主要成果:

  • 在UNSW-NB15数据集上,SIML方法实现了93.7%的准确率和95%的精确率.
  • 梯度提升算法在线设置中表现出优越的性能,与传统方法相比.
  • 该方法在BoT-Iot和Edge-IIoTset数据集上表现出优势,在更高的吞吐量时有轻微的退化.

结论:

  • SIML提供了一种强大,分布式和有效的解决方案,用于保护物联网环境免受网络威胁.
  • 拟议的方法显著提高了物联网设备的安全性,减少了它们对利用的脆弱性.
  • 这项研究通过先进的物联网安全措施,为更安全,更有弹性的数字未来做出了贡献.
